Also, the real cruncher with this is the fact that the timer always goes back up...
So basically they can go on (and generally do) forever!
e.g.
counting down from 30 seconds... 5...4...3..2..1.... and someone bids. Back up to 30 seconds.... wait wait wait 5....4....3....2...1 and someone bids.
Repeat.
So you not only have to buy a load of tokens, you then have to sit there wasting your time trying to snipe the end of the auction... which could go on forever (that mini was on there well over a month ago!).
As such, it's just a big lottery. The only difference is the fact that you'll waste your time first.
